Exit 1 — What’s Nearby?

This exit is in the direction of Baniyas Road and the Dubai Creek waterfront. If your destination is Dubai Creek for a dhow cruise or a casual stroll along the waterfront towards Deira Corniche or any of the hotels and restaurants located along the waterfront, then you should take this exit.  

Exit 2 — What’s Nearby?

This exit will prove to be best for you if you are heading to the Gold Souk, Spice Souk, or Naif Souk. This exit will take you to the streets of Old Deira. This exit is the most popular exit for tourists who are heading to this destination.

Food & Dining Around Union Metro Station

The food available in Deira is some of the cheapest food available in Dubai. There are many restaurants available near Union Station to cater to the people residing in this area, too. The food available in these restaurants would cost around AED 15-30.

If one wants to take some food with them, there are many street food stalls available near Spice Souk and Gold Souk, where one can get food such as fresh fruit juices, shawarma, etc., at any time of the day. If one wants to take a proper meal, there are many halal food restaurants available on Baniyas Road, where one can get all kinds of food available in Deira.

How to Use Your NOL Card at Union Station

NOL cards can be topped up at:

  • Ticket vending machines inside the station
  • Customer service counters (for larger top-ups or card issues)
  • The RTA Dubai app (mobile top-up, with a short sync delay before use)

RTA Dubai App

If you are not in a position to use your NOL card, then look for the RTA staff. The staff will always be available at any time of the day. The staff will always be in a position to assist you with your problem. Your problem could be that the money in your NOL card is not sufficient or that your NOL card will not be in a position to function unless you tap twice to sync your recent top-up done through your mobile phone.

Facilities Inside Union Metro Station

  • Ticket vending machines and customer service counters near the main entry
  • Lifts, ramps, and full wheelchair access at all levels
  • Retail kiosks selling snacks, beverages, and convenience items
  • Washrooms on the concourse level
  • Prayer rooms are accessible within the station
  • Designated ladies’ and children’s carriages (the rear car is reserved)
  • Wi-Fi is available throughout the Dubai Metro network, including Union Station
  • Lost and found: Contact RTA directly via the app or call center for items left on trains or at the station

Insider Tips for Using Union Metro Station Like a Local

  • Avoid traveling between 7:45 and 9:00 AM and 5:30 and 7:30 PM on weekdays. The Red Line gets genuinely packed during these windows, particularly heading toward the airport or downtown.
  • Board toward the back of the train if you’re heading to the Gold Souk exit. The rear carriages align more conveniently with Exit 2.
  • During Ramadan, metro hours shift—the Friday schedule often applies across the week. Double-check timing during this period.
  • Google Maps works well for metro directions in Dubai, but the RTA app is more accurate for real-time bus connections from Union Station’s terminus.
  • Keep your bag in front of you in the souk areas around the station. The neighborhoods are safe, but Deira is busy and crowded — basic awareness goes a long way.
